Subject: SquatGuard scanner rollout

Team,

Ahead of the weekly sync: the SquatGuard typo-squatting package scanner is now live on the internal registry at Brellux. It flags new package names within edit distance two of our published libraries and quarantines them pending review. False-positive rate in staging was under 3%. Rollout to the Veldane mirror happens Thursday. Questions go to the platform channel before Wednesday noon. The build that shipped is identified below.

build token for kagaf-hahof: htk14_9d3d4d26d7d8de

Ticket #988 — Vault locked us out of Fabrikit seeds

Heads up for the eng sync: the vault holding the Fabrikit test-data factory seed configs locked itself after last night's token rotation. Fixture generation is blocked until someone unseals it. Grint rotated the credential this morning, so use the new recovery passphrase below.

unlock words, hahip-baduf: holwyn-istath-julvan

## Runbook: Fernhollow locker access flow

Release manager: before promoting any build of the Fernhollow laundry-locker service, verify the access flow end to end. A test resident must request a drop-off, receive a one-time unlock code, open locker bank C in the Midden Street pilot site, and see the occupancy state sync within ten seconds. If the code screen times out, the kiosk firmware is stale — halt the release. All verification runs must use the staging tier, whose service configuration is reproduced below.

deployment values, faduf-tawep:
SORDOR_LOG_LEVEL=error
SORDOR_METRICS_HOST=metrics.sordor.nelvrolabs.internal
SORDOR_POOL_SIZE=4